R. Lukaku - one leg in "Inter" club

"Manchester United" striker Romelu Lukaku, who wants to leave this summer, is approaching a move to Inter Milan. According to "Sky Sports" journalist Fabrizio Romano, both clubs have already reached an agreement, and the 26-year-old Belgian will sign a five-year contract with the Milan team. It is reported that "Man Utd" will receive an immediate payment of 65 million pounds sterling for the forward, and this amount could rise to 77 million in the future. R. Lukaku was recently very close to a move to another Italian team, Juventus, but at that time "Man Utd" failed to reach an agreement on terms with Paulo Dybala, who would have been exchanged for the Belgian striker. In this situation, Inter took advantage, with their new coach Antonio Conte openly showing his admiration for Lukaku. Last season, R. Lukaku played 45 matches and scored 15 goals for "The Red Devils."
